Cinnamon, ginger, and cloves boost the taste of this traditional whole-berry cranberry sauce. Vary the character by adding toasted nuts or other fruits. Use leftover sauce in our Dinner Tonight recipes. Ingredients:
1 1/2 cups sugar |
3/4 cup fresh orange juice (about 3 oranges) |
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on |
1/4 teaspoon ground ginger |
dash of ground cloves |
1 (12-ounce) package fresh cranberries |
1 tablespoon grated orange rind |
Directions:
1. Combine first 6 ingredients in a medium saucepan; bring to a bo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to medium; cook 12 minutes or until cranberries pop. Remove from heat; stir in rind. Cool completely. Serve chilled or at room temperature. |
